The analysis begins with a question of whether you are seeking to get her here on a permanent visa or a temporary visa. We are not sure how she has a travel document. In general, if she has a travel document then we are thinking that you (or someone) has applied for a green card for her. This needs to be ascertained. If she has a travel document (Advance Parole) then you can have her come to the States using that document. The questions that you ask is complex and we recommend strongly that you seek guidance from competent immigration legal counsel.
